p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/converters/p5-JSON-XS



Module Name:    pkgsrc
Committed By:   wiz
Date:           Sun Sep 14 06:49:38 UTC 2025

Modified Files:
        pkgsrc/converters/p5-JSON-XS: Makefile distinfo

Log Message:
p5-JSON-XS: update to 4.04.

4.04 Fri 05 Sep 2025 23:59:48 CEST
        - fix heap overflow causing crashes, possibly information
          disclosure or worse (CVE-2025-40928), and causes JSON::XS to
          accept invalid JSON texts as valid in some cases. Thanks to
          Michael Hudak for finding this, the CPAN Security Group for
          coordinating this, and Reini Urban for double-checking the patch
          (and Peter Juhasz for potentially reporting this much earlier).


To generate a diff of this commit:
cvs rdiff -u -r1.45 -r1.46 pkgsrc/converters/p5-JSON-XS/Makefile
cvs rdiff -u -r1.29 -r1.30 pkgsrc/converters/p5-JSON-XS/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/converters/p5-JSON-XS/Makefile
diff -u pkgsrc/converters/p5-JSON-XS/Makefile:1.45 pkgsrc/converters/p5-JSON-XS/Makefile:1.46
--- pkgsrc/converters/p5-JSON-XS/Makefile:1.45  Fri Jul  4 08:44:51 2025
+++ pkgsrc/converters/p5-JSON-XS/Makefile       Sun Sep 14 06:49:38 2025
@@ -1,8 +1,7 @@
-# $NetBSD: Makefile,v 1.45 2025/07/04 08:44:51 wiz Exp $
+# $NetBSD: Makefile,v 1.46 2025/09/14 06:49:38 wiz Exp $
 
-DISTNAME=      JSON-XS-4.03
+DISTNAME=      JSON-XS-4.04
 PKGNAME=       p5-${DISTNAME}
-PKGREVISION=   5
 CATEGORIES=    converters perl5
 MASTER_SITES=  ${MASTER_SITE_PERL_CPAN:=JSON/}
 

Index: pkgsrc/converters/p5-JSON-XS/distinfo
diff -u pkgsrc/converters/p5-JSON-XS/distinfo:1.29 pkgsrc/converters/p5-JSON-XS/distinfo:1.30
--- pkgsrc/converters/p5-JSON-XS/distinfo:1.29  Tue Oct 26 10:06:46 2021
+++ pkgsrc/converters/p5-JSON-XS/distinfo       Sun Sep 14 06:49:38 2025
@@ -1,5 +1,5 @@
-$NetBSD: distinfo,v 1.29 2021/10/26 10:06:46 nia Exp $
+$NetBSD: distinfo,v 1.30 2025/09/14 06:49:38 wiz Exp $
 
-BLAKE2s (JSON-XS-4.03.tar.gz) = 690ede4dd813b03fbcd254788c21239b19203b2a9526d4e51422e9da9e8162ac
-SHA512 (JSON-XS-4.03.tar.gz) = 7d2c20302b0f98bd69e692b61d272b58c13a79741f3e2e44ee0530e21dd239526477f8b02e4afbfe41ee83cb69ab1c5247bf0be355f3f09e9cfe31b2ea4a5155
-Size (JSON-XS-4.03.tar.gz) = 86749 bytes
+BLAKE2s (JSON-XS-4.04.tar.gz) = 16110b50157c3baf6b6bda2dc8048cb7114e051b31ee256b8b0aa57410bc9ac3
+SHA512 (JSON-XS-4.04.tar.gz) = 018d02c7db58a8469afd8454c7822602a50d09a1658e41511ae38bc0f0cfe88f180758ae1dc0f1a933869c8e5c1e7535a2e4d312a9d206544df0ccb4cba11295
+Size (JSON-XS-4.04.tar.gz) = 87082 bytes



Home | Main Index | Thread Index | Old Index